-- An even simpler framework for creating 2D charts in Haskell.
--
-- The basic idea is to make it as easy to plot as octave, which means that
-- you provide no more information than you wish to provide. We provide
-- four plotting functions, which differ only in their output. One
-- produces a "Layout1" that you can customize using other
-- Graphics.Rendering.Chart functions. The other three produce their
-- output directly. All three accept the same input and produce the same plots.
--
-- The plot functions accept a variable number of arguments. You must
-- provide a [Double] which defines the points on the x axis, which must
-- precede any of the "y" values. The y values may either be [Double] or
-- functions. After any given y value, you can give either Strings or
-- PlotKinds describing how you'd like that y printed.
